Immigration for Same-Sex Couples

As a result of the Supreme Court's recent decisions overturning the Defense of Marriage Act and legalizing same-sex marriage nationwide, U.S. citizens, permanent residents and other visitors can now obtain a wide range of immigration benefits for their same-sex spouses.  Same-sex marriages are now considered valid for purposes of U.S. immigration law so long as the couple's marriage was recognized in the U.S. state or foreign country where the marriage was celebrated.
